Has the Defence Investment Plan weakened UK's global reputation?
One silver lining of receiving less funding than requested in the Defence Investment Plan is that it will force the UK to be more creative, think in new ways, and move beyond previously established approaches. That is the view of Justin Crump, a former British Army tank commander and chief executive of intelligence and risk consultancy Sibylline.
